Toronto Raptors’ Kyle Lowry on NBA trade deadline – ‘Whatever will be will be’ – ESPN Australia
Kyle Lowry reflected on the possibility that Wednesday night marked his last game in a Toronto Raptors uniform, saying, “It was different tonight, for sure.”

Toronto Raptors guard Kyle Lowry repeatedly insisted Wednesday night that he doesn’t know what will happen between now and Thursday’s 3 p.m. ET NBA trade deadline.
But that didn’t stop an air of finality from hanging over the proceedings following a 135-111 victory over the visiting Denver Nuggets, as the greatest player in Raptors franchise history spoke to the media for what likely will be his final time in a Toronto uniform.
